@chrisreynolds65204 жыл бұрын
Nice runs...That being said, not faster than a HR! Not talking trash but it wouldn't touch my 07 G35 HR Sedan. 326 hp and 282 tq at the ground. Intakes, Headers, 2.5" custom dual exhaust, Stillen underdrive pulley, 08 G37 170F thermostat, Uprev tuned by me. I found nearly 30 hp and 50 ft/lbs in the HR engine from cam phasing adjustments.

@@chrisreynolds6520 do you think the stillen underdrive pulley would have a better impact on throttle response for vq3.5 engine compared to a pedal commander?
@chrisreynolds65204 жыл бұрын
@@cedricmiller4370 Never used a pedal commander. My Uprev throttle mapping can be tuned as aggressive as one wants. My car tends to hold lower gears starting off uphill now. Not uncommon to see it shift around 5,000 rpm on an uphill ramp at around 1/3 throttle. Just a little throttle goes a long way. The underdrive pulley was noticeable off the line, especially with the a/c on. I can run the a/c now and it feels the same as without the a/c going before. With the stock pulley you could really feel the compressor drag on the engine.
